php伪协议;PHP伪协议解析与应用
PHP伪协议是一种特殊的URL协议,它可以在PHP中通过文件操作函数来访问各种资源,如文件、数据库、网络等。围绕PHP伪协议展开,介绍其解析与应用,并为读者提供相关的背景信息。
一、PHP伪协议的概述
1.1 什么是PHP伪协议
PHP伪协议是一种特殊的URL协议,以"php://"开头,用于在PHP中访问各种资源。
1.2 PHP伪协议的背景
PHP伪协议的出现是为了方便开发者在PHP中进行文件操作、数据库查询等常见操作,提高开发效率。
二、PHP伪协议的解析
2.1 文件操作
PHP伪协议可以通过文件操作函数如file_get_contents、file_put_contents等来读写文件,实现文件的读写操作。
2.2 数据库查询
PHP伪协议可以通过数据库操作函数如mysqli_query、PDO::query等来进行数据库查询,实现对数据库的读取和写入。
2.3 网络请求
PHP伪协议可以通过网络请求函数如file_get_contents、curl等来发送HTTP请求,实现与其他服务器的通信。
2.4 图片处理
PHP伪协议可以通过GD库的相关函数如imagecreatefromjpeg、imagepng等来处理图片,实现图片的生成、裁剪、缩放等操作。
2.5 数据流操作
PHP伪协议可以通过数据流操作函数如fopen、fwrite等来读写数据流,实现对数据流的操作。
2.6 其他应用
PHP伪协议还可以用于其他一些应用场景,如读取远程文件、获取系统信息等。
三、PHP伪协议的应用
3.1 文件读写应用
PHP伪协议可以用于读取、写入文件,实现文件的读写操作,方便开发者进行文件处理。
3.2 数据库查询应用
PHP伪协议可以用于进行数据库查询操作,方便开发者对数据库进行读取和写入。
3.3 网络请求应用
PHP伪协议可以用于发送HTTP请求,实现与其他服务器的通信,方便开发者进行接口调用、数据交互等操作。
3.4 图片处理应用
PHP伪协议可以用于处理图片,实现图片的生成、裁剪、缩放等操作,方便开发者进行图片处理。
3.5 数据流操作应用
PHP伪协议可以用于读写数据流,方便开发者对数据流进行操作,如读取、写入等。
3.6 其他应用场景
PHP伪协议还可以用于其他一些应用场景,如读取远程文件、获取系统信息等,方便开发者进行相关操作。
通过对PHP伪协议的解析与应用的介绍,我们可以看到PHP伪协议的强大功能和广泛应用。它不仅可以方便开发者进行文件操作、数据库查询等常见操作,还可以用于网络请求、图片处理、数据流操作等多个应用场景。掌握PHP伪协议的使用,将有助于提高开发效率,并且在实际项目中发挥更大的作用。